Jainendra Public School kids celebrate Christmas with joy
Panchkula, Jan. 9 -- Jainendra Public School celebrated Christmas and New Year with great enthusiasm and cultural splendour, fostering the spirit of love, harmony, and togetherness among students.
The programme commenced with a serene Shabad by our musical choir headed by music teacher and Christmas dance by the Tiny Tots, which created an atmosphere of devotion and peace. This was followed by a melodious carol and devotional song, beautifully presented by the students, conveying the universal message of goodwill and compassion. A thought-provoking Nukkad Natak was staged, highlighting an important social message of using one's wisdom with confidence and clarity. The festive spirit reached its vibrant culmination with an energetic Giddha performance by the 'Stunners', which enthralled the audience with its rhythm, grace, and traditional charm. Principal Leena Sood appreciated the efforts put up by the house Stunners and extended her heartfelt best wishes and blessings to all, urging students to embrace the values of love, discipline, and service, and to welcome the New Year with renewed hope and positivity....
